From Ballot Access News, August 23, 2013:
New Mexico Secretary of State Dianna J. Duran, a Republican, recently removed the Green Party and the Constitution Party from the ballot, even though both parties successfully petitioned in 2012 and even though, for the last seventeen years, New Mexico law has been interpreted to mean that when a party successfully petitions for party status, it gets the next two elections, not just one election.…

Ballot Access News, August 6, 2013:
The South Dakota Secretary of State has released the August 1 tally of the number of registered voters. The percentages are: Republican 45.77%; Democratic 35.49%; independent 18.44%; Libertarian .23%; Constitution .069%.
